Searched refs:upvals (Results 1 – 6 of 6) sorted by relevance
/external/lua/src/ |
D | lfunc.c | 38 while (n--) c->upvals[n] = NULL; in luaF_newLclosure() 52 cl->upvals[i] = uv; in luaF_initupvals()
|
D | lvm.c | 618 if (c->upvals[i]->v != v) in getcached() 642 ncl->upvals[i] = luaF_findupval(L, base + uv[i].idx); in pushclosure() 644 ncl->upvals[i] = encup[uv[i].idx]; in pushclosure() 645 ncl->upvals[i]->refcount++; in pushclosure() 833 setobj2s(L, ra, cl->upvals[b]->v); in luaV_execute() 837 TValue *upval = cl->upvals[GETARG_B(i)]->v; in luaV_execute() 849 TValue *upval = cl->upvals[GETARG_A(i)]->v; in luaV_execute() 856 UpVal *uv = cl->upvals[GETARG_B(i)]; in luaV_execute() 1287 LClosure *ncl = getcached(p, cl->upvals, base); /* cached closure */ in luaV_execute() 1289 pushclosure(L, p, cl->upvals, base, ra); /* create a new one */ in luaV_execute()
|
D | lapi.c | 1007 setobj(L, f->upvals[0]->v, gt); in lua_load() 1008 luaC_upvalbarrier(L, f->upvals[0]); in lua_load() 1212 *val = f->upvals[n-1]->v; in aux_upvalue() 1213 if (uv) *uv = f->upvals[n - 1]; in aux_upvalue() 1264 return &f->upvals[n - 1]; /* get its upvalue pointer */ in getupvalref()
|
D | lgc.c | 518 UpVal *uv = cl->upvals[i]; in traverseLclosure() 689 UpVal *uv = cl->upvals[i]; in freeLclosure()
|
D | lobject.h | 456 UpVal *upvals[1]; /* list of upvalues */ member
|
D | ldebug.c | 562 if (c->upvals[i]->v == o) { in getupvalname()
|